I am using roots organic 707 soil. Also have the roots organic nutes.
 
you might wanna check out calmg+ from general organic.calimagic isnt on the OMRI list, usually that means they use synthetic chelating salts in their calimagic. which will disrupt and even kill some of your microbial herd
